Shadowsocks 配置文件位置及详细指南

Shadowsocks 是一种安全的代理工具,用于保护用户的网络隐私和突破网络限制。在使用 Shadowsocks 时,了解配置文件的位置是非常重要的。本文将为您详细解答 Shadowsocks 配置文件在哪个位置 的问题,并提供相关的使用指导和常见问题解答。

什么是 Shadowsocks 配置文件?

Shadowsocks 的配置文件是一个包含连接信息的文件,通常以 JSON 格式存储。这些信息包括服务器地址、端口号、密码、加密方式等,是用户连接 Shadowsocks 服务器的基础。正确配置该文件能保证连接的稳定性和安全性。

Shadowsocks 配置文件的存放位置

Windows 系统

在 Windows 系统上,Shadowsocks 的配置文件一般位于以下位置:

  • C:\Users\<用户名>\AppData\Local\Shadowsocks\config.json

macOS 系统

对于 macOS 用户,配置文件通常可以在以下路径找到:

  • ~/Library/Application Support/ShadowsocksX-NG/config.json

Linux 系统

在 Linux 系统上,Shadowsocks 的配置文件位置可能因安装方式而异,常见路径包括:

  • /etc/shadowsocks/config.json
  • ~/.config/shadowsocks/config.json

Android 和 iOS

对于移动设备,Shadowsocks 的配置通常在应用内进行管理,不会以文件的形式存在。

如何编辑 Shadowsocks 配置文件?

编辑配置文件之前,请确保您有相应的权限。以下是编辑 Shadowsocks 配置文件的基本步骤:

  1. 打开配置文件:根据您操作系统的不同,使用文本编辑器打开相应的配置文件。
  2. 修改配置:根据您的需要,更新服务器地址、端口号、密码等信息。
  3. 保存文件:确保保存文件时使用正确的编码(通常为 UTF-8)。
  4. 重启 Shadowsocks:修改配置后,重启 Shadowsocks 服务以使更改生效。

常见配置参数解释

在配置文件中,您可能会看到以下常见参数:

  • server:服务器地址,填写您要连接的 Shadowsocks 服务器的 IP 或域名。
  • server_port:服务器端口号,确保与服务器配置一致。
  • password:连接密码,这是您连接服务器的关键。
  • method:加密方式,常用的有 aes-256-gcmchacha20-ietf-poly1305 等。
  • timeout:连接超时时间,单位为秒。

使用 Shadowsocks 的注意事项

使用 Shadowsocks 进行网络代理时,需要注意以下几点:

  • 确保您的配置文件正确无误,以免影响连接。
  • 使用强密码和安全的加密方式,保护您的网络安全。
  • 定期更新您的服务器地址和配置,防止被封锁。

FAQ(常见问题解答)

Shadowsocks 配置文件丢失了怎么办?

如果您丢失了 Shadowsocks 的配置文件,您可以通过以下方式恢复:

  • 检查您的计算机回收站,是否能够找到被删除的配置文件。
  • 如果有备份,请从备份中恢复配置文件。
  • 重新配置服务器信息,并保存为新的配置文件。

如何导入 Shadowsocks 配置文件?

导入配置文件的方法如下:

  • 打开 Shadowsocks 客户端,进入设置菜单。
  • 选择“导入配置”选项,选择您的配置文件(如 config.json)进行导入。

能否使用多个 Shadowsocks 配置文件?

是的,您可以使用多个配置文件进行不同的连接。在客户端中,您可以手动切换配置文件,也可以使用导入功能加载不同的配置。

Shadowsocks 配置文件需要定期更新吗?

是的,建议定期更新配置文件中的服务器地址和端口,以确保能够连接到可用的服务器,并防止被封锁。

结论

通过本篇文章的介绍,您现在应该清楚 Shadowsocks 配置文件在哪个位置 以及如何正确使用和编辑它。保持您的配置文件安全且最新,将有助于您更好地利用 Shadowsocks 工具,保护您的网络隐私。希望本文能够对您有所帮助!

正文完